Hail Rosato by Vincenzo Nardone is a light and fresh red, an unusual expression of Aglianico from historic vineyards. Born in Venticano, Irpinia, from ancient vines aged 40-60 years cultivated according to the regenerative Organic Forest philosophy, without any chemical interventions. Vinification is respectful: direct pressing and spontaneous fermentation with indigenous yeasts via pied de cuve, with a minimal addition of sulfites (total 19 mg/l). Aging lasts 5 months in steel, with bâtonnage on fine lees, followed by 4 months in bottle.
A drinkable and unconventional red, unfiltered and unfined, revealing an unusual, fresh, and immediate Aglianico.
